Kailash
कैलाश“One who is like a crystal; abode of Lord Shiva.”
Derived from the Sanskrit word 'kailāsa', referring to Mount Kailash in the Himalayas, which is considered the sacred abode of Lord Shiva. The name symbolizes purity, spiritual height, and transcendence in Hindu tradition.
